修改osp中allbug的显示界面
This commit is contained in:
parent
a4d1e036f4
commit
e901e8046d
|
@ -2,23 +2,23 @@
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
<div class="contextual-borad">
|
<div style="width: 940px">
|
||||||
|
|
||||||
<div class="borad-topic-count" style="margin-top:10px">
|
<div class="borad-topic-count" style="margin-top:10px; width: 600px">
|
||||||
<span>共有 <%= link_to @bug_count %> 个安全贴子 </span>
|
<span>共有 <%= link_to @bug_count %> 个安全贴子 </span>
|
||||||
</div>
|
</div>
|
||||||
<div style="padding-top: 10px">
|
<div style="padding-top: 10px ;width: 940px">
|
||||||
<% if @bugs.any? %>
|
<% if @bugs.any? %>
|
||||||
<% @bugs.each do |bug| %>
|
<% @bugs.each do |bug| %>
|
||||||
<% topic = bug.bug %>
|
<% topic = bug.bug %>
|
||||||
<table class="content-text-list">
|
<table style="width: 940px" class="content-text-list">
|
||||||
<tr>
|
<tr>
|
||||||
<td colspan="2" valign="top" width="50" ><%= link_to image_tag(url_to_avatar(topic.author), :class => "avatar"), user_path(topic.author) if topic.author%>
|
<td colspan="2" valign="top" width="50" ><%= link_to image_tag(url_to_avatar(topic.author), :class => "avatar"), user_path(topic.author) if topic.author%>
|
||||||
<%= image_tag('../images/avatars/User/0', :class => "avatar") unless topic.author%> </td>
|
<%= image_tag('../images/avatars/User/0', :class => "avatar") unless topic.author%> </td>
|
||||||
<td>
|
<td>
|
||||||
<table width="630px" border="0">
|
<table border="0">
|
||||||
<tr>
|
<tr>
|
||||||
<td valign="top" width="500px" class="<%= topic.sticky ? 'sticky' : '' %> <%= topic.locked? ? 'locked' : '' %>">
|
<td valign="top" width="700px" class="<%= topic.sticky ? 'sticky' : '' %> <%= topic.locked? ? 'locked' : '' %>">
|
||||||
<% if topic.url.nil? || topic.url == '' %>
|
<% if topic.url.nil? || topic.url == '' %>
|
||||||
<%= link_to h(topic.subject), open_source_project_relative_memo_path(bug.open_source_project, topic) %>
|
<%= link_to h(topic.subject), open_source_project_relative_memo_path(bug.open_source_project, topic) %>
|
||||||
<% else %>
|
<% else %>
|
||||||
|
|
|
@ -146,30 +146,11 @@ li {
|
||||||
<div class="col2">
|
<div class="col2">
|
||||||
<div> <span> <h1 style="fontsize:19px">软件安全态势</h1></span><span style="margin-top: -30px; margin-right:70px;float: right; display: block;"><%= link_to '更多 >>', allbug_open_source_projects_path %></span></div>
|
<div> <span> <h1 style="fontsize:19px">软件安全态势</h1></span><span style="margin-top: -30px; margin-right:70px;float: right; display: block;"><%= link_to '更多 >>', allbug_open_source_projects_path %></span></div>
|
||||||
<div class="fixed"></div>
|
<div class="fixed"></div>
|
||||||
<div id ="buglist" class="li_list" style="margin-top:10px;margin-left:10px">
|
<div class="li_list" style="margin-top:10px;margin-left:10px">
|
||||||
<ul style="list-style-type: square;">
|
<ul style="list-style-type: square;">
|
||||||
<% @bugs.each do |bug| %>
|
<% @bugs.each do |bug| %>
|
||||||
<li><span class="li_time">[<%= show_description_of_bug(bug) %>]</span><%= link_to bug.bug.subject, bug.bug.url, :target => '_blank' %>
|
<li><span class="li_time">[<%= show_description_of_bug(bug) %>]</span><%= link_to bug.bug.subject, bug.bug.url, :target => '_blank' %></li>
|
||||||
<a href="/vuldb/ssvid-62261" title="Cobbler 2.4.x - 2.6.x 本地文件包含">Cobbler 2.4.x - 2.6.x 本地文件包含</a></li>
|
|
||||||
<% end %>
|
<% end %>
|
||||||
|
|
||||||
<!-- <li><span class="li_time">[DDoS漏洞]</span><a href="/vuldb/ssvid-62261" title="Cobbler 2.4.x - 2.6.x 本地文件包含">Cobbler 2.4.x - 2.6.x 本地文件包含</a></li>
|
|
||||||
|
|
||||||
<li><span class="li_time">[OpenSSL漏洞]</span><a href="/vuldb/ssvid-62260" title="Ruby OpenSSL CA私钥伪造漏洞">Ruby OpenSSL CA私钥伪造漏洞</a></li>
|
|
||||||
|
|
||||||
<li style="color: red"><span class="li_time">[远程溢出漏洞]</span><a href="/vuldb/ssvid-62259" title="Adobe Flash Player 整数堆栈下溢远程命令执行">Adobe Flash Player 整数堆栈下溢远程命令执行</a></li>
|
|
||||||
|
|
||||||
|
|
||||||
<li ><span class="li_time">[SQL注入漏洞]</span><a href="/vuldb/ssvid-62256" title="Apache/NGINX 下 PHP-FPM 或者 PHP-CGI 拒绝服务漏洞">Apache/NGINX 下 PHP-FPM 拒绝服务漏洞</a></li>
|
|
||||||
|
|
||||||
<li><span class="li_time">[SQL注入漏洞]</span><a href="/vuldb/ssvid-62250" title="AlienVault OSSIM SQL注入以及远程代码执行">AlienVault OSSIM SQL注入以及远程代码执行</a></li>
|
|
||||||
|
|
||||||
<li><span class="li_time">[DDoS漏洞]</span><a href="/vuldb/ssvid-62248" title="Eucalyptus Web Services拒绝服务漏洞">Eucalyptus Web Services拒绝服务漏洞</a></li>
|
|
||||||
|
|
||||||
<li ><span class="li_time">[OpenSSL漏洞]</span><a href="/vuldb/ssvid-62245" title="Watchguard Fireware XTM OpenSSL TLS心跳信息泄漏漏洞">Watchguard Fireware XTM OpenSSL TLS心跳...</a></li>
|
|
||||||
|
|
||||||
<li style="color: red"><span class="li_time">[OpenSSL漏洞]</span><a href="/vuldb/ssvid-62244" title="SAP Sybase SQL Anywhere OpenSSL TLS泄漏漏洞">SAP Sybase SQL Anywhere OpenSSL TLS</a></li>
|
|
||||||
-->
|
|
||||||
</ul>
|
</ul>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
|
@ -4,6 +4,7 @@
|
||||||
margin: 0px 0 0 0;
|
margin: 0px 0 0 0;
|
||||||
width: 970px;
|
width: 970px;
|
||||||
|
|
||||||
|
|
||||||
}
|
}
|
||||||
.header2{
|
.header2{
|
||||||
float: left;
|
float: left;
|
||||||
|
@ -15,6 +16,7 @@
|
||||||
width: 100%;
|
width: 100%;
|
||||||
right: 50%;
|
right: 50%;
|
||||||
background-color: #000000
|
background-color: #000000
|
||||||
|
|
||||||
}
|
}
|
||||||
.col1{
|
.col1{
|
||||||
position: relative;
|
position: relative;
|
||||||
|
@ -28,13 +30,15 @@
|
||||||
position: relative;
|
position: relative;
|
||||||
overflow: hidden;
|
overflow: hidden;
|
||||||
float: left;
|
float: left;
|
||||||
width: 470px;
|
width: 440px;
|
||||||
left: 3%;
|
left: 3%;
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
a:hover, a:active {
|
a:hover, a:active {
|
||||||
color: #c61a1a;
|
color: #c61a1a;
|
||||||
text-decoration: underline;
|
text-decoration: underline;
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
#tag {
|
#tag {
|
||||||
|
@ -49,3 +53,13 @@ text-decoration: underline;
|
||||||
text-decoration: none;
|
text-decoration: none;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
#buglist
|
||||||
|
{
|
||||||
|
overflow: hidden;
|
||||||
|
overflow-x: hidden;
|
||||||
|
overflow-y: hidden;
|
||||||
|
white-space: nowrap;
|
||||||
|
text-overflow: ellipsis;
|
||||||
|
-o-text-overflow: ellipsis;
|
||||||
|
}
|
||||||
|
|
||||||
|
|
|
@ -4,7 +4,6 @@
|
||||||
clear:both;
|
clear:both;
|
||||||
padding:0 0 0 0px;
|
padding:0 0 0 0px;
|
||||||
|
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
@ -34,6 +33,7 @@ padding:0;
|
||||||
background-color:#105DB5;
|
background-color:#105DB5;
|
||||||
color:#FFF;
|
color:#FFF;
|
||||||
text-decoration:none;
|
text-decoration:none;
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
.li_list li,.na_list li {
|
.li_list li,.na_list li {
|
||||||
|
|
Loading…
Reference in New Issue